Georgetown, the oldest district in DC, was formerly a bustling port city. It still offers hints of its past with remnants of mule-drawn boats and flour mills. Explore Georgetown’s multicultural history where individuals from all corners of the globe and various religions coexisted, fostering a diverse gastronomic community.
